[아하] 블록체인 오류 발생! 어떻게 수정할까

홈 > 코인정보 > 최신정보뉴스
최신정보뉴스

[아하] 블록체인 오류 발생! 어떻게 수정할까

분자파수꾼 4 112 8

2890211928_hYRMECje_4ef5ca1fed7751ded0d6afbffd959b213ebf0112.jpg 

[aha! 블록체인] Q> 암호화폐를 개발하는 과정에서 우연치 않게 블록체인 코드 상 오류를 발견하게 된다면 개발자들은 어떻게 수정을 하는지 궁금합니다. 블록체인 특성 상 이미 발행한 코인에 대해서 코드 수정을 하는 게 쉽지는 않아 보이는데요. 답변 부탁드립니다.


 

 


 

블록체인 코드 상에 심각한 문제나 오류가 발견된다면 포크(Fork)를 통해 수정할 수 밖에 없다고 생각합니다.


 

 


 

다시 말해서 어떤 심각한 문제를 발견한 후, 최대한 빠른 시간 안에 해당 문제나 오류를 수정한 코드를 블록체인에 적용하기 위해 포크가 필요한 것입니다. 이때 소프트포크로 해결이 가능하다면 그렇게 해야겠지만, 소프트포크로 해결이 되지 않는다면 하드포크를 통해 해결할 수밖에 없습니다.


 

 


 

포크의 경우는 보통 클라이언트 소프트웨어를 수정함으로써 이루어지는데, 블록체인 메인넷의 경우는 테스트넷에서의 충분한 검증을 거친 후 하드포크가 진행됩니다. 말씀하신 것처럼 나중에 심각한 문제가 발생하는 경우는 드물다고 할 수 있습니다.


 

 


 

끝으로 신속하게 대응할 수 있는 문제인지 아닌지에 따라 수정에 대한 방법은 달라질 수 있습니다. 문제나 오류를 고치기 위해 필요한 작업의 규모에 따라서도 포크 방식이 달라질 수 있는 것입니다. 따라서 프로젝트 입장에서는 상황에 맞는 적절한 방식을 선택하여, 최대한 빠르게 문제를 수정할 수 있는 방법을 결정하는 것이 필요하다고 볼 수 있습니다.”


 

 


 

*이 글은 블록체인 지식 커머스 플랫폼 ‘아하(Aha)’ 블록체인 분야 Q&A 가운데 '한뚝배기'님의 질문과 ‘erc20’님의 답변을 재구성한 것입니다.


 

원문: https://www.a-ha.io/questions/4baa894417767db5bad314a1e9d2fed0


최신기사 


출처: Joind (https://joind.io/market/id/2141) 

4 Comments
소소함 05.24 00:58  
감사합니다!
임곡 05.24 01:43  
화이팅 입니다
망고2 05.24 04:49  
화이팅 입니다
kurae31 05.24 21:01  
감사합니다

오늘의 인기글
실시간 새글

CP보유량 회원 Top10